How to Style Wide-Leg Pants for a Job Interview in 2027

Direct Answer
For a job interview in 2027, wide-leg pants are a polished, modern choice when paired with a structured top and refined accessories. The key is balancing the pants' volume with a fitted or tailored upper half. Opt for a high-waisted cut in a trouser-weight fabric like wool or ponte, and finish with a closed-toe shoe and a minimalist bag to project confidence and professionalism.
What to Wear
The core of this look is a wide-leg trouser in a neutral or deep tone—think charcoal, navy, black, or olive. Pair it with a silk blouse, a fine-gauge knit, or a tailored button-down in a complementary solid or subtle pattern. Blazers are optional but recommended for a more formal setting; a cropped or longline style works best. For footwear, choose loafers, kitten heels, or low block heels—brands like Cole Haan and Allbirds offer interview-appropriate options. Everlane and Mango are excellent sources for the pants themselves, while Ann Taylor and J.Crew provide versatile tops and blazers. Stick to a monochromatic palette with one accent piece, like a leather belt or gold earrings, to keep the look cohesive and commanding.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Wearing pants that are too long or drag on the floor. Hem them to break just above the shoe for a clean line.
- Pairing with a baggy or oversized top. Always balance volume with a fitted or tucked-in upper half to maintain structure.
- Choosing low-rise or unlined wide-leg pants. High-waisted and lined styles create a smoother silhouette and prevent transparency.
- Over-accessorizing with loud patterns or logos. Keep jewelry and bags minimal and tonal to avoid distracting from your face.
- Ignoring the shoe silhouette. Avoid chunky sneakers or open-toe sandals; opt for polished loafers, pumps, or derbies that ground the look.
FAQ
Can I wear wide-leg pants to a conservative industry interview? Yes, if you choose a dark neutral like charcoal or navy in a wool or ponte fabric, pair it with a structured blazer and closed-toe shoes, and ensure the pants are hemmed properly. This reads as modern yet respectful.
What length should wide-leg pants be for an interview? The hem should fall just above the floor, grazing the top of your shoe without pooling. A 1-inch break is ideal; cuffs can add weight and a tailored finish.
Are wide-leg pants appropriate for a virtual interview? Absolutely. Choose a high-waisted pair in a solid color, and pair with a contrasting or matching top that sits well on camera. Avoid very light colors that may wash out on screen.
How do I avoid looking frumpy in wide-leg pants? Tuck in your top or choose a cropped blazer to define your waist. Stick to structured fabrics (wool, ponte) and avoid overly soft or jersey materials that can sag. Add a belt for extra definition.
Can I wear sneakers with wide-leg pants to an interview? Only in very casual or creative industries. If you do, choose minimalist leather sneakers in black or white from brands like Allbirds or Cole Haan, and ensure the pants are cropped or hemmed to show the shoe.
